The strongest association signal was obtained for rs7349332 (P=3.55 × 10(-15)) on chr2q35, which is located intronically in WNT10A. Expression studies in human hair follicle tissue suggest that WNT10A has a functional role in Androgenetic Alopecia etiology. Thus, our study provides genetic evidence supporting an involvement of WNT signaling in Androgenetic Alopecia development.
